What Is Power System Frequency?How Did 50 Hz and 60 Hz Frequencies Emerge?What Are The Advantages and Disadvantages of Different Frequencies?How Is Power System Frequency Controlled?ConclusionPower system frequency is defined as the rate of change of the phase angle of AC voltage or current, measured in hertz (Hz). One hertz equals one cycle per second. Frequency depends on the speed of the generators producing the AC voltage—faster rotation means higher frequency.
